Summary

Whiteaker Middle School is a public middle school in Keizer, Oregon, serving 732 students in grades 6-8. The school is part of the Salem-Keizer School District 24J, which is ranked 110 out of 140 districts in the state.

Whiteaker Middle School consistently outperforms the district and state in English Language Arts and Mathematics proficiency, with 40.4% of 6th-graders and 29% of 8th-graders meeting proficiency standards, compared to the district's 33.9% and 22.7%, respectively. The school also performs well for certain student subgroups, such as Multi-racial and Gifted and Talented students. However, the school struggles with English Language Learner students, ranking in the bottom 10% of Oregon middle schools for this group. Whiteaker's high chronic absenteeism rate, ranging from 34.3% to 47.9%, is a significant concern.

Compared to nearby schools, Whiteaker Middle School generally outperforms other middle schools in the district, but two local charter schools, Howard Street Charter and Jane Goodall Environmental Middle Charter School, significantly outperform Whiteaker in both English Language Arts and Mathematics proficiency. Despite higher per-student spending and a higher student-teacher ratio than the district average, Whiteaker's performance has declined over the past few years, as evidenced by its decreasing statewide ranking and star rating.
